    Can anyone explain to me the purpose of the small gasket under the left side crankcase cover on the VF500F engine? It is part # 11343-KE7-306, reference item 3 on fiche page "LEFT CRANKCASE COVER @ WATER PUMP." This in on the backside of the cover that the slave clutch cylinder gets removed from. It doesn't appear to seal anything.

    The reason I ask is because I had this cover powercoated (after leaking brake fluid destroyed it), and the gasket was destroyed during removal. Of course the part is no longer available, so I suppose I can make one out of gasket material if necessary.
